The design of the Phola coal preparation has its roots in the late 1980s when there was a requirement for a plant to treat 8 Mtpa coal from Ingwe's (now BECSA's) adjacent Klipspruit opencast mine at Ogies, Mpumalanga. The mine is part of the South African Witbank Coalfield and accesses the No. 2 and 4 Seams with some 5 Seam material.

DRA is in the process of designing the coal processing plant for Resgen's Boikarabelo mine in the Lephalale area in Limpopo province. As part of the design and verification process, DRA has to determine the plant constraints and capabilities and determine the stockpile sizes for the run-of-mine (ROM) and product stockpiles.

Construction of the new Phola coal processing plant has begun in Mpumalanga. Mining giants BHP Billiton and Anglo American are joint 50:50 partners in the plant, which is expected to be completed in the second half of 2009. Many coal plants are mine mouth which means the plant was put where the coal mine is, so the coal doesn't need to be transported by train. Once unloaded, the coal is then pulverized into a fine powder by a large grinder. This ensures nearly complete burning of the coal in order to maximize the heat given off and to minimize pollutants.

run of the mine coal. Simple de-shaling, improved mining procedures and sizing of coal could bring down the average ash content of Indian coal to around 35% from the current level of over 40%. Full washing could reduce the ash content further, thereby saving transport costs and resulting in more efficient power plant design and operation.

The design and operation of coal preparation plants are governed by the inherent quality of the raw coal to be processed, market specifications and the saleable tonnage requirements. Where does the coal go after it leaves the mine? The coal is shipped by train or barge to its destination. The coal may be refined before shipping. Washing with water or a chemical bath to remove some impurities. When the coal arrives at the power plant, it is pulverized into a heavy powder that is suitable for burning.
